How to prepare for a job interview at Elliott Recruitment Solutions Limited
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you’re well-versed in bathroom installation processes and the latest trends in the industry. Brush up on technical knowledge and be ready to discuss your previous projects, as this will show your expertise and passion for the role.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
As a Bathroom Installation Manager, you'll need to lead a team effectively. Prepare examples of how you've successfully managed teams in the past, resolved conflicts, or improved project efficiency. This will demonstrate your capability to handle the responsibilities of the role.
✨Understand the Company Culture
Research the company’s values and mission. Tailor your responses to reflect how your personal values align with theirs. This shows that you’re not just looking for any job, but that you genuinely want to be part of their team.
✨Prepare Questions
Have a few thoughtful questions ready to ask at the end of the interview. This could be about their future projects, team dynamics, or growth opportunities within the company. It shows your interest and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
